I'm assembling user manuals from a collection of previously written
documents, each one with at least one screenshot, and each screenshot
identified as a Figure. The docs total multiple hundreds of pages each. I've
got the pages nicely numbered using descriptive letters. For example, AS-100,
CM-45, and so forth. I would like the many screenshots to be similarly
numbered, from Figure 1 to Figure N. And indeed, in one of the documents this
has happened without my even telling it to. Lucky me! However, in the others,
the Figure numbers reset themselves to one at the beginning of each chapter.
I can't for the life of me figure this out... I've ALT F9ed for code because
I've used it in the headers to display section titles based on the level 1
and 2 headers, plus a header graphic linked to a file. My question is, of
course, how can I get the Figure numbers to reset themselves?
I am using Word 2002 10.6612.6626 SP3 on an HP Win 2000 Pro box.
